The Upton boys basketball team has recorded 7 straight seasons of at least 20 wins and capped the 2023-24 campaign with the 3rd State Championship in the last 4 years thanks to a 55-36 win over Saratoga in the 1A Final on Saturday. The Bobcats held a 34-19 advantage at the intermission and shot 47% from the field for the game. They did this by the way with just 6 turnovers with 11 assists on 24 field goals. The Bobcats got a terrific effort from Ethan Schiller who dropped in 17 points on 8-12 from the floor. Rhett Watt added 14 and Logan Timberman had 10.

Saratoga needed a 30-foot buzzer beater to win their opening round game of the 1A State Tournament but found some rough sledding on Saturday going 6-22 from the field in the 2nd half. The Panthers also struggled from the 3-point line going 3-18 and got 14 points from Finn Rolseth and 9 from Hazen Williams. Saratoga went 19-5 this season and has finished no lower than 3rd at the  1A State Tournament over the last 5 years.

Upton went 26-1 this season and has not absorbed a losing season since 2012. We have a short video of the proceedings at the Ford Center in Casper to share with you along with some images of the title contest in our gallery below. Enjoy!
